Sentinel-6 will provide the only means of accurately measuring global sea level, helping to protect the 600 million people who live in vulnerable coastal areas across the globe, the UK government said.The satellite is named after the former head of NASA's Earth science division - Dr Michael Freilich - and is a part of the Copernicus mission under the European Union's Earth observation program.
It was jointly developed by ESA, the European Organisation for the Exploitation of Meteorological Satellites, NASA, and the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ration. UK science minister Amanda Solloway said:"Tracking rising sea levels is one of the most important indicators of our planet warming up.
"This government-backed satellite will arm our leading scientists, researchers and meteorologists with critical data to measure the true impact of climate change on our planet".
